编程入门课程视频(编程入门自学视频)
今天给各位分享编程入门课程视频的知识,其中也会对编程入门自学视频进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始...
扫一扫用手机浏览
大家好,今天小编关注到一个比较有意思的话题,就是关于arm编程入门的问题,于是小编就整理了2个相关介绍arm编程入门的解答,让我们一起看看吧。
1. 了解ARM处理器的基本结构,如指令集、编程模型及体系结构等;
4. 熟悉ARM编程的开发工具与环境,如Keil MDK、ARM RealView等;
5. 掌握ARM编程应用os相关知识,如Cortex M4、Linux等;
6. 实现ARM编程应用,如硬件驱动、网络协议及实时操作系统等。
1、ARM既可以认为是一个公司的名字,也可以认为是对一类微处理器的通称,还可以认为是一种技术的名字。
2、ARM公司是专门从事基于RISC技术芯片设计开发的公司,作为知识产权供应商,本身不直接从事芯片生产,而是转让设计许可,由合作公司生产各具特色的芯片。
3、ARM处理器的内核是统一的,由ARM公司提供,而片内部件则是多样的,由各大半导体公司设计,这使得ARM设计嵌入式系统的时候,可以基于同样的核心,使用不同的片内外设,从而具有很大的优势
ARM是以嵌入式为基础的。
嵌入式系统的定义是,指以应用为中心,以计算机技术为基础,软件、硬件可裁剪,适应应用系统对功能、可靠性、成本、体积、功耗严格要求的专用计算机系统。
ARM体系架构有:ARMv1、ARMv2、ARMv3、ARMv4、ARMv5、ARMv6、ARMv7、ARMv8架构,不同的体系架构***用不同指令集。哈佛结构是数据和指令分开存储并运行的;冯诺依曼结构是混合存储的。
到此,以上就是小编对于arm编程入门的问题就介绍到这了,希望介绍关于arm编程入门的2点解答对大家有用。